Can you share more about the craftsmanship behind the traditional mirror work on Rajasthani sarees?

Rajasthani sarees are renowned for their exquisite mirror work, known as shisha embroidery. Artisans hand-stitch these mirrors onto the fabric, creating dazzling patterns that symbolize prosperity and good fortune. This intricate craftsmanship not only enhances the sari's aesthetic but also honors the rich cultural traditions of Rajasthan.
